    Isaac Redman said that, despite coming off his worst game as a professional, Pittsburgh Steelers coach Mike Tomlin still had confidence in him.

    The veteran running back apparently was right.

    Redman will start at running back Monday night against the Cincinnati Bengals despite fumbling twice and rushing for just nine yards on eight carries in Pittsburgh's 16-9 season-opening loss to the Tennessee Titans.
